The University of Saint Francis-Fort Wayne is a private university located in Fort Wayne, Indiana, founded in 1890. Known for its strong emphasis on Franciscan values and community service, it is recognized for its nursing and education programs. The university has a picturesque campus with a serene lake at the center, providing a peaceful environment for students.

Historical Tuition Costs

Based on historical data, in-state tuition is expected to rise by approximately $992 per year over the next three years, reaching $36,267 in 2024, and $37,259 in 2025, and $38,251 in 2026.

Admissions

University of Saint Francis-Fort Wayne admissions is not very selective with an acceptance rate of 98%. The application deadline can be found on the institution's website.
